Q: Is 72,164,006 a Prime Number?

 A: No, 72,164,006 is not a prime number.

Why is 72,164,006 not a prime number?

A prime number is a natural number, greater than one, that can only be divided by 1 and itself.

The number 72164006 can be evenly divided by 1 2 29 58 251 502 4,957 7,279 9,914 14,558 143,753 287,506 1,244,207 2,488,414 36,082,003 and 72,164,006, with no remainder.

Since 72,164,006 cannot be divided by just 1 and 72,164,006, it is not a prime number.
